A bill to amend the Communications Act of 1934 to extend the authority of the Federal Communications Commission to grant a license or construction permit through a system of competitive bidding.

This bill changes a deadline for the Federal Communications Commission's ability to grant licenses and construction permits through competitive bidding. Specifically, it extends an expiration date for this authority from one date to a later date.
The Federal Communications Commission is directly affected by this bill.
• The deadline for the FCC's authority to grant licenses or construction permits through competitive bidding is extended to September 30, 2023 (Sec. 1)
The expiration date in Section 309(j)(11) of the Communications Act of 1934 changes from March 9, 2023 to September 30, 2023. This gives the FCC additional time to conduct competitive bidding for licenses and construction permits.
